“We didn’t give it our all.” Dynamo footballer Makarov talks about ninth place last season

Midfielder of Dynamo Moscow Denis Makarov believes that last season the team’s players did not always show their maximum abilities.

At the end of the 2022/23 season, the “blue and white” took ninth place in the Russian championship. In May, it was announced that Slavisa Jokanovic had resigned as the team’s head coach this season. “Dynamo” directed by Marcel Lička.

“I’ll be honest: this season has been very difficult both emotionally and physically. We have completely failed. The match wasn’t great, but we were still third or fourth before the break, and after the winter break everything went downhill. It seemed like a good season, but the last few games showed that we didn’t deserve to be in the top three. In two games, they dropped to ninth place. At the time our football, to be honest, wasn’t very good. We understood it perfectly, but there was nothing we could do. It’s probably a question of attitude. We are all a team on the ground. Probably somewhere they didn’t give everything, that’s why this happened,” Makarov said as quoted by “Championship”.
